Baked Leche Flan


Ingredients:

1&1/2  cups white sugar
14  egg yolks
1  egg
3  cups fresh carabao’s or cow’s milk
pinch of chopped lemon rind

How to make Baked Leche Flan

  • Dissolve 1 cup white sugar over moderate heat to caramelize it.
  • Pour evenly on bottom and sides of molder. Set aside.
  • Preheat oven to 375 deg F. In a mixing bowl, combine egg yolks and whole egg.
  • Add 1/2 cup sugar, lemon rind and milk. Mix thoroughly but gently so as not to form air bubbles.
  • Pour into prepared caramel-lined pan. Put the pan in a large, shallow baking pan containing water. Bake in the oven for 45 minutes.

Note: It is difficult to work with carabaos milk. Using too much heat will coagulate it and the result will be a mealy, gritty flan. Some sellers adulterate it with coconut milk so be sure it is pure. Cow’s milk is an acceptable substitute, but the consistency of the flan will be less rich.
